Grand Forks’s location in the Red River Valley means roofs face significant challenges. With approximately 48 inches of annual snowfall, winter temperatures that drop well below zero, with temperatures dropping to -20°F or colder, and 35+ per year thunderstorm days bringing hail and high winds, roofing systems here work hard. The community rebuilt stronger after 1997 with improved infrastructure and flood protection – and quality roofing remains essential protection for every property. Frequently Asked Questions: Storm & Hail Damage Repair in Grand Forks
How do I know if my roof has hail damage?
Signs include dented or cracked shingles, granule loss (check gutters), dents in metal flashing or vents, and damaged gutters. On metal agricultural buildings, look for dents in panels. After any significant hailstorm, schedule a professional inspection – damage isn’t always visible from the ground.
Do you repair storm damage on agricultural buildings?
Yes. We repair hail and wind damage on pole barns, machine sheds, storage facilities, and other agricultural buildings throughout Grand Forks County. Prompt repair protects expensive equipment and stored crops from further weather exposure.
How long do I have to file an insurance claim?
Most policies require claims within 1 year of damage, but sooner is better. Documentation quality matters, and evidence can deteriorate. We document damage thoroughly and can help you understand the claim process.
